The Moral Implications of Gambling

Gambling has long been a topic of debate, invoking strong opinions about its ethical implications. At its core, gambling presents a conflict between personal freedom and social responsibility. Many argue that individuals should have the autonomy to make their own choices, including the decision to engage in gambling activities. However, this freedom becomes contentious when considering the potential for addiction and financial ruin that gambling can impose on vulnerable populations. Moreover, the moral landscape of gambling is further complicated by the role of gambling institutions, which often profit from the losses of players. This raises questions about the fairness of gambling practices and whether companies should implement measures to protect players. Balancing profit motives with ethical responsibility remains a complex challenge in the industry.

Responsible Gambling Practices

Responsible gambling refers to a set of principles and practices aimed at ensuring that individuals can gamble in a way that minimizes harm. This includes self-regulation techniques, such as setting limits on time and money spent. Educational campaigns by casinos and online gambling platforms play a crucial role in promoting awareness and understanding of responsible gambling.

Furthermore, many jurisdictions have implemented regulatory frameworks that require gambling operators to provide resources for players, such as self-exclusion programs and access to counseling services. By prioritizing responsible gambling, the industry acknowledges its ethical obligations to protect players while fostering a fair gaming environment.

The Role of Regulation in Ensuring Fairness

Regulation is essential in the gambling landscape to create a level playing field for all participants. Government authorities often establish strict guidelines for gambling operators, ensuring that games are fair and that advertising does not mislead consumers. Such regulations are designed to prevent exploitation and promote transparency within the industry.

Moreover, regulatory bodies can help to address concerns about problem gambling by monitoring operators and enforcing compliance with ethical standards. This oversight is vital in building trust between players and operators, enhancing the reputation of gambling as a legitimate form of entertainment rather than a predatory practice.

Impact of Technology on Gambling Ethics

The advent of online gambling has transformed the ethics of the industry, introducing new challenges and opportunities. Digital platforms offer unprecedented access to gambling but can also create risks, such as increased anonymity that may lead to irresponsible behavior. This shift has prompted stakeholders to reconsider ethical guidelines to ensure they are relevant in the digital age.

Additionally, technology can be harnessed to promote ethical gambling practices. Data analytics, for example, can help identify patterns of problematic behavior, allowing operators to intervene proactively. As technology continues to evolve, so too must the ethical frameworks that govern the gambling landscape, ensuring that fairness and responsibility remain central to the industry.
